Bean Blossom Township, Monroe County, Indiana

Bean Blossom Township is one of eleven townships in Monroe County, Indiana, United States. As of the 2010 census, its population was 2,916 and it contained 1,184 housing units.[3]

History edit

Secrest Ferry Bridge was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1996.[4]

Geography edit

According to the 2010 census, the township has a total area of 36.35 square miles (94.1 km2), of which 36.34 square miles (94.1 km2) (or 99.97%) is land and 0.01 square miles (0.026 km2) (or 0.03%) is water.[3] The White River defines the northwest boundary of the township.

Cemeteries edit

The township contains these four cemeteries: Ellett, King, Mount Carmel and Van Buskirk.
